Unbeaten super bantamweight Randy Caballero (18-0, 10 KOs) scored a seventh round KO over a tough Miguel Robles (12-3-2, 5 KOs) on Saturday night at the Fantasy Springs Resort Casino in Indio, California.

Caballero had his hands full with the Puerto Rican fighter but a vicious body shot in the seventh sent Robles crashing to the canvas and in obvious pain.  A couple of earlier shots seemed to soften up the mid section of Robles and a crippling left hook to the stomach finished the job.  Robles was counted out by referee Jack Reiss as he remained on the canvas. Time was 2:06.

“In the beginning, we wanted to out-box him and keep him at a distance but after the fifth round I told my dad [Trainer] ‘It’s not working, lets change it up and go inside.”  Said Caballero “We took him inside and worked the body, I seen him slowing down and that body shot just went in perfect”

On the undercard,

2012 Olympian featherweight Joseph “Jo Jo” Diaz (6-0, 4 KOs) stopped Luis Cosme (8-3-1, 4 KOs) in the first round of a scheduled six. An over-hand right to the head, followed by a left hook to the body dropped Cosme to the canvas. Referee Jack Reiss would wave it off after a ten count. official time was 2:09.

2012 Olympian junior middleweight Errol Spence Jr. (7-0, 6 KOs) also crushed his foe Eddie Cordova (4-5-1, 1 KO) with a crippling body shot in the opening round. Time was 2:13

Junior lightweights Eric Ituarde (5-0-1, 0 KOs) and Humberto Zatarin (3-1-2, 0 KOs) fought to a four round unanimous decision draw. Scores were 38-38 all around

Local fighter Angel Osuna (11-3-1) scored a second round KO over Christian Nava (2-4-1) at the 2:08.

Heavyweight Alex Rivera (1-0) stopped C.J. Leveque (0-1) at the 2:07 mark of the first round of his pro-debut.
